Quote from: gordo on March 24, 2018, 06:57:50 PM
Does anyone have any info on the Tiger?  I'm in the troubleshooting phase and not sure what any of the pots actually do at this point.

Comparing the Tiger and White Horse schematics, most of the pots are in about the same locations. Looking at the boards  of both pedals and the pot locations on the front of built ones, I would guess (please correct me):
A10k   - Level
C100k - Sustain
B1k    - Blend
A50k  - High pass filter
